What Are Dot Symbols

Dot symbols are small round Unicode characters used as bullet points, dividers, decoration, and typographic marks. They range from a tiny period-sized dot to bold filled circles, and include specialized characters like the middle dot used in typography and file naming conventions.

What Is the Middle Dot

The middle dot, also called the center dot or interpunct, is the character · (Unicode U+00B7). It sits vertically centered between letters rather than at the baseline like a period. It is commonly used to separate syllables in dictionaries, as a multiplication sign in math, and as a stylistic divider in usernames and bios. On Windows you can type it using Alt+0183 on the numeric keypad, and on Mac it is Option+Shift+9.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I type a middle dot?

On Windows, hold Alt and type 0183 on the numeric keypad. On Mac, press Option+Shift+9. You can also just click the middle dot symbol above to copy it directly.

What is the alt code for center dot?

The alt code for the center dot (·) is Alt+0183, typed while holding Alt and using the numeric keypad on Windows.

What is the Unicode for middle dot?

The middle dot’s Unicode code point is U+00B7, officially named “Middle Dot” in the Unicode standard.

What is the HTML entity for middle dot?

The HTML entity for the middle dot is · or the numeric code ·, both of which render as ·.

What is the difference between a dot and a bullet point?

A dot like · or . is a small punctuation mark, while a bullet point like • is a larger, bolder character specifically designed to mark items in a list.
